What Key Features Should You Look for in a Lawn Mower for a 20 Acre Lot?

When searching for the best lawn mower for a 20-acre lot, it’s essential to consider various key features that ensure efficiency and effectiveness.

  • Engine Power: Look for a mower with a powerful engine, typically between 20 to 30 horsepower, to handle the large expanse of land and tougher grass types.
  • Cutting Width: A wider cutting deck, around 60 inches or more, allows you to cover more ground in fewer passes, significantly reducing mowing time.
  • Fuel Type: Choose between gasoline and diesel engines, as diesel offers better fuel efficiency and longevity, which is ideal for extensive areas.
  • Drive Type: Opt for a zero-turn mower or a garden tractor; zero-turn mowers are highly maneuverable and suitable for navigating around trees and obstacles.
  • Durability and Build Quality: A well-built mower with robust materials will withstand the rigors of mowing 20 acres, ensuring longevity and reduced maintenance costs.
  • Comfort Features: Ergonomic seating and adjustable controls enhance user comfort, especially for longer mowing sessions, making the task less tiring.
  • Additional Attachments: Consider mowers that can accommodate attachments like baggers, mulchers, or plows, adding versatility to your lawn care tasks.
  • Maintenance Accessibility: Look for designs that allow easy access to engine and blade components, as simple maintenance helps extend the life of the mower.

Engine power is crucial, as a robust engine will efficiently tackle the various terrains and grass densities found on a large lot. A cutting width of at least 60 inches will allow you to minimize the time spent mowing, making the process more efficient.

The choice of fuel type can impact your operational costs; diesel engines, while often more expensive upfront, can provide longer service intervals and better fuel economy. The drive type determines how easily you can navigate your property; zero-turn mowers excel in maneuverability, while garden tractors may offer better stability for larger areas.

Durability is key when investing in a lawn mower for such a large area; a mower made from high-quality materials will withstand frequent use. Comfort features, such as a well-cushioned seat and user-friendly controls, are essential for reducing fatigue during long mowing sessions.

Additional attachments can transform a lawn mower into a multi-functional tool, allowing you to handle tasks beyond just mowing. Lastly, maintenance accessibility is important; a design that allows you to easily reach engine parts and blades will save you time and help maintain your mower’s performance over the years.

Which Types of Lawn Mowers Are Most Effective for Large Properties?

The most effective types of lawn mowers for large properties, especially for a 20-acre lot, include:

  • Riding Lawn Mowers: Ideal for large areas, these mowers provide comfort and efficiency.
  • Zero-Turn Mowers: These offer exceptional maneuverability and speed, making them perfect for intricate landscaping.
  • Tractor Mowers: Suitable for heavy-duty tasks, these can handle rough terrain and large attachments.
  • Commercial-Grade Mowers: Designed for professional use, they offer durability and high performance over extensive areas.
  • Robotic Lawn Mowers: An innovative choice for those seeking automation, these mowers can manage vast spaces with minimal effort.

Riding Lawn Mowers: Riding lawn mowers are popular for large properties due to their ability to cover vast areas quickly while providing the operator with a comfortable seating position. They often come equipped with features such as adjustable cutting heights and large grass collection bags, making them efficient for maintaining extensive lawns.

Zero-Turn Mowers: Zero-turn mowers are known for their exceptional maneuverability, allowing users to make tight turns and navigate around obstacles with ease. With faster cutting speeds and larger cutting decks, they significantly reduce mowing time on large lots, making them an excellent choice for properties with complex landscaping.

Tractor Mowers: Tractor mowers are robust machines that can handle challenging terrains and are often compatible with various attachments such as tillers and snow plows. They are ideal for large properties that may require more than just mowing, providing versatility for different landscaping tasks.

Commercial-Grade Mowers: These mowers are built for heavy usage and are ideal for maintaining large properties consistently. They feature powerful engines, reinforced frames, and advanced cutting technology, ensuring they can handle the demands of a 20-acre lot without compromising performance.

Robotic Lawn Mowers: Robotic lawn mowers offer a modern solution for large properties, utilizing sensors and mapping technology to efficiently cut grass with minimal human intervention. While they require an initial investment, they provide convenience and can maintain the lawn with little ongoing effort, making them an attractive option for busy property owners.

What Role Does Engine Power and Cutting Width Play in Lawn Mower Selection?

When selecting the best lawn mower for a 20-acre lot, engine power and cutting width are critical factors to consider.

  • Engine Power: The engine power of a lawn mower is crucial as it determines the mower’s ability to handle thick grass and uneven terrain.
  • Cutting Width: The cutting width affects how quickly you can mow large areas, as a wider cutting deck allows you to cover more ground in fewer passes.

Engine Power: A more powerful engine, typically measured in horsepower or cubic centimeters (cc), can drive the mower through tougher conditions and maintain performance without bogging down. For a 20-acre lot, an engine with at least 20-25 hp is recommended to efficiently manage large, potentially uneven surfaces and dense growth. Additionally, a powerful engine often translates to greater durability and longevity, as it can sustain prolonged use without overheating.

Cutting Width: The cutting width, which can range from 30 inches to over 60 inches in commercial models, directly impacts mowing efficiency. A wider cutting deck means fewer passes are needed to mow the entire lot, significantly reducing the time spent on the task. However, it’s important to balance width with maneuverability; if the mower is too wide for narrow paths or areas with obstacles, it may require more effort to navigate effectively.

What Maintenance Tasks Are Essential for Keeping Lawn Mowers in Top Condition?

Essential maintenance tasks for keeping lawn mowers in top condition include:

  • Regular Oil Changes: Changing the oil in your lawn mower is crucial for its longevity and performance. Fresh oil lubricates the engine components, reducing friction and heat buildup, which can lead to premature wear and failure.
  • Air Filter Cleaning or Replacement: The air filter keeps dirt and debris from entering the engine. A clean air filter ensures proper airflow, improving engine efficiency and preventing potential damage due to contaminants.
  • Blade Sharpening: Sharp blades are essential for a clean cut and overall lawn health. Dull blades can tear grass rather than cut it, leading to a rough appearance and increased susceptibility to disease.
  • Fuel System Maintenance: Keeping the fuel system clean and using fresh fuel can prevent starting issues and engine problems. Regularly draining old fuel and using a fuel stabilizer can help maintain the integrity of the fuel system.
  • Battery Care (for Electric Mowers): For electric mowers, maintaining the battery is critical. Regularly checking the battery’s charge and connections, and ensuring it’s stored properly during the off-season, can extend its life and performance.
  • Tire Pressure Checks: Maintaining proper tire pressure ensures optimal traction and even cutting. Under-inflated tires can lead to uneven mowing, while over-inflated tires can cause the mower to bounce and make it difficult to control.
  • Deck Cleaning: Cleaning the mower deck helps prevent grass buildup, which can lead to rust and affect performance. Regularly removing clippings and debris ensures efficient operation and prolongs the life of the deck.
  • Cable and Belt Inspection: Inspecting cables and belts for wear can prevent sudden failures during operation. Replacing worn or frayed cables and belts ensures smooth operation and reduces the risk of breakdowns.
